Imo state being the most educationally advanced state in the SE region coupled with the amount of secondary and tertiary institutions is enough reason why it should be a major centre for education, also with its numerous professionals in various fields such as finance, accounting, engineering (futo) it should be the corporate headquarters for companies. Its also an investment heaven for oil and most especially gas engineering and energy generation given its large deposits of natural gas. And lastly, as we all would agree its a tourist (oguta blue lake resort) and entertainment hub given its aesthetic and serene environment. I believe the principle of comparative advantage and specialization will fast track the development of alaigbo. We should all end the issue of stereotyping each other. 1 Like |
